Публикации по теме 'programming-tips'


Почему многие люди имеют дело с таким сложным языком программирования, как C++, когда есть Python, который…
Есть несколько причин, по которым люди по-прежнему предпочитают иметь дело со сложным языком программирования, таким как C++, несмотря на существование более простых альтернатив, таких как Python. Во-первых, C++ — это высокоэффективный и мощный язык, который широко используется в таких отраслях, как игры, финансы и высокопроизводительные вычисления. Его низкоуровневый характер и способность напрямую манипулировать аппаратными ресурсами делают его идеальным выбором для таких типов..

Рефакторинг JavaScript - 5 распространенных проблем, на которые следует обратить внимание, и способы их решения
5 вещей, которых никогда не должно быть в вашем JS-коде Рефакторинг похож на Бесконечную историю : вы можете подумать, что все готово, но пока сюжет (проект) продолжается, всегда есть место для новых изменений. Это нормально, это часть нашей работы - всегда пытаться адаптировать, изменять, настраивать и настраивать наш код, чтобы он оставался поддерживаемым и стабильным еще долгое время после того, как был написан изначально. Проблема, однако, возникает, когда мы сосредотачиваемся..

Работа с API Google Книг
Работа с API Google Книг Придумывать решения с помощью программирования — увлекательный, но интригующий опыт. С одной стороны, это позволяет человеку понять реальный процесс, стоящий за поведением приложений. С другой стороны, это может быть сложно, особенно если не соблюдаются основные правила программирования, например, принцип программирования «Не повторяйся» (DRY) . Тем не менее, погружение в мир программирования захватывает и приносит удовлетворение тем фактом, что помогает..

Как получить доступ к свойствам дочернего компонента в Vue.js 3
Полезный совет для доступа к методам и функциям из дочерних компонентов При создании приложений Vuejs вам может потребоваться доступ к свойствам дочернего компонента из внешнего компонента. Это может быть в сценариях, где нет необходимости генерировать события. Доступ к компонентам с помощью ссылок возможен благодаря открытому характеру компонентов в Vuejs2. В то время как в Vuejs 3 компоненты закрыты по умолчанию, мы не можем получить доступ к свойствам компонента, используя refs...

Основные инструменты разработчика для десятикратного увеличения производительности
Как разработчик программного обеспечения, вы постоянно ищете способы повысить свою производительность и оптимизировать рабочие процессы. Правильные инструменты могут иметь большое значение, экономя ваше время и усилия и помогая добиваться лучших результатов. Вот некоторые важные инструменты для разработчиков, которые могут помочь вам в 10 раз повысить производительность: Редакторы кода. Хороший редактор кода может значительно улучшить ваш рабочий процесс. Популярные варианты включают..

Создание модальных окон с помощью React Portals
В этой статье рассказывается о том, почему мы должны использовать React Portal при работе с модальными окнами (окнами сообщений). Он разбит на 2 раздела: Почему модальные окна без портала не рекомендуются Применить портал React для модальных окон Почему модальные окна без портала не рекомендуются Компоненты React разработаны таким образом, что между всеми компонентами существует иерархия. Например, рассмотрим следующее приложение Который можно разбить на множество слоев..

Не бойтесь // TODO
Не бойтесь // TODO Используйте инструменты, существующие в Visual Studio, для отслеживания незавершенных задач и повышения производительности. Visual Studio отслеживает ваши “// TODO” комментарии В Visual Studio выберите Просмотр - › Список задач . Откроется окно Список задач и любая область открытого Решения, в которой есть комментарии, начинающиеся с // TODO . Вы можете отфильтровать до «Текущий проект», «Текущий документ» или «Открытые документы». Это даже позволит вам..